#af9b2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#af9b2c is composed of 68.6% red, 60.8%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.4% magenta, 74.9%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 50.8 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 42.9%. #af9b2c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ff58 with #5f3700.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#af9b2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#af9b2c has RGB values of R:175, G:155,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.75,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11508524.
